public class RoleService extends AbstractSimpleService<RoleRequestInputBuilder, RoleRequestOutput> {
private static final Logger LOG = LoggerFactory.getLogger(RoleService.class);
private final DeviceContext deviceContext;
public RoleService(final RequestContextStack requestContextStack, final DeviceContext deviceContext, final Class<RoleRequestOutput> clazz) {
super(requestContextStack, deviceContext, clazz);
this.deviceContext = deviceContext;
}
@Override
protected OfHeader buildRequest(final Xid xid, final RoleRequestInputBuilder input) throws ServiceException {
input.setXid(xid.getValue());
return input.build();
}
public Future<BigInteger> getGenerationIdFromDevice(final Short version) {
LOG.info("getGenerationIdFromDevice called for device: {}", getDeviceInfo().getNodeId().getValue());
// send a dummy no-change role request to get the generation-id of the switch
final RoleRequestInputBuilder roleRequestInputBuilder = new RoleRequestInputBuilder();
roleRequestInputBuilder.setRole(toOFJavaRole(OfpRole.NOCHANGE));
roleRequestInputBuilder.setVersion(version);
roleRequestInputBuilder.setGenerationId(BigInteger.ZERO);
final SettableFuture<BigInteger> finalFuture = SettableFuture.create();
final ListenableFuture<RpcResult<RoleRequestOutput>> genIdListenableFuture = handleServiceCall(roleRequestInputBuilder);
Futures.addCallback(genIdListenableFuture, new FutureCallback<RpcResult<RoleRequestOutput>>() {
@Override
public void onSuccess(final RpcResult<RoleRequestOutput> roleRequestOutputRpcResult) {
if (roleRequestOutputRpcResult.isSuccessful()) {
final RoleRequestOutput roleRequestOutput = roleRequestOutputRpcResult.getResult();
if (roleRequestOutput != null) {
LOG.debug("roleRequestOutput.getGenerationId()={}", roleRequestOutput.getGenerationId());
finalFuture.set(roleRequestOutput.getGenerationId());
} else {
LOG.info("roleRequestOutput is null in getGenerationIdFromDevice");
finalFuture.setException(new RoleChangeException("Exception in getting generationId for device:" + getDeviceInfo().getNodeId().getValue()));
}
} else {
LOG.error("getGenerationIdFromDevice RPC error " +
roleRequestOutputRpcResult.getErrors().iterator().next().getInfo());
}
}
@Override
public void onFailure(final Throwable throwable) {
LOG.info("onFailure - getGenerationIdFromDevice RPC error {}", throwable);
finalFuture.setException(new ExecutionException(throwable));
}
});
return finalFuture;
}
public Future<RpcResult<SetRoleOutput>> submitRoleChange(final OfpRole ofpRole, final Short version, final BigInteger generationId) {
LOG.info("submitRoleChange called for device:{}, role:{}",
getDeviceInfo().getNodeId(), ofpRole);
final RoleRequestInputBuilder roleRequestInputBuilder = new RoleRequestInputBuilder();
roleRequestInputBuilder.setRole(toOFJavaRole(ofpRole));
roleRequestInputBuilder.setVersion(version);
roleRequestInputBuilder.setGenerationId(generationId);
final ListenableFuture<RpcResult<RoleRequestOutput>> roleListenableFuture = handleServiceCall(roleRequestInputBuilder);
final SettableFuture<RpcResult<SetRoleOutput>> finalFuture = SettableFuture.create();
Futures.addCallback(roleListenableFuture, new FutureCallback<RpcResult<RoleRequestOutput>>() {
@Override
public void onSuccess(final RpcResult<RoleRequestOutput> roleRequestOutputRpcResult) {
LOG.info("submitRoleChange onSuccess for device:{}, role:{}",
getDeviceInfo().getNodeId(), ofpRole);
final RoleRequestOutput roleRequestOutput = roleRequestOutputRpcResult.getResult();
final Collection<RpcError> rpcErrors = roleRequestOutputRpcResult.getErrors();
if (roleRequestOutput != null) {
final SetRoleOutputBuilder setRoleOutputBuilder = new SetRoleOutputBuilder();
setRoleOutputBuilder.setTransactionId(new TransactionId(BigInteger.valueOf(roleRequestOutput.getXid())));
finalFuture.set(RpcResultBuilder.<SetRoleOutput>success().withResult(setRoleOutputBuilder.build()).build());
} else if (rpcErrors != null) {
LOG.trace("roleRequestOutput is null , rpcErrors={}", rpcErrors);
for (RpcError rpcError : rpcErrors) {
LOG.warn("RpcError on submitRoleChange for {}: {}",
deviceContext.getPrimaryConnectionContext().getNodeId(), rpcError.toString());
}
finalFuture.set(RpcResultBuilder.<SetRoleOutput>failed().withRpcErrors(rpcErrors).build());
}
}
@Override
public void onFailure(final Throwable throwable) {
LOG.error("submitRoleChange onFailure for device:{}, role:{}",
getDeviceInfo().getNodeId(), ofpRole, throwable);
finalFuture.setException(throwable);
}
});
return finalFuture;
}
private static ControllerRole toOFJavaRole(final OfpRole role) {
ControllerRole ofJavaRole = null;
switch (role) {
case BECOMEMASTER:
ofJavaRole = ControllerRole.OFPCRROLEMASTER;
break;
case BECOMESLAVE:
ofJavaRole = ControllerRole.OFPCRROLESLAVE;
break;
case NOCHANGE:
ofJavaRole = ControllerRole.OFPCRROLENOCHANGE;
break;
default:
// no intention
LOG.warn("given role is not supported by protocol roles: {}", role);
break;
}
return ofJavaRole;
}
}
